Role of MCC – NEET Seat Allotment 2023

Medical Counselling Committee will be conducting seat allotment method of NEET 2023 for the beneath-introduced quotas:

  • 15% AIQ seats of all the seats.

  • 100% seats of BHU/ AIIMS/ DU for MBBS/ BDS.

  • 100% seats of JIPMER seats for Puducherry & Karaikal.

  • 85% SQ seats of DU/ IP University.

  • 15% IP quota seats of ESIC.

  • 100% seats for Dentistry including 5% quota for Jamia students

NEET 2023 seat allotment: Key highlights

  • NEET 2023 seats are split into All India quota & State-level quota.

  • Centralized counselling will be done to fill 15% All India quota seats of MBBS & BDS courses.

  • The remaining seats will be allotted through normal counselling procedure.

  • All the medical colleges private, deemed, armed forces will be participating in NEET 2023 seat allotment.

  • AIIMS & JIPMER will as well accept the aspirants through NEET UG 2023 exam. These colleges are no longer conducting their own medical entrance exam.

Required Documents for NEET 2023

Aspirants who are eligible for the counselling rounds require to report to the institute with documents. Here are the lists of documents you’ve to carry.

  • NEET exam 2023 hall ticket
  • The rank letter or Result of NEET 2023
  • Mark sheet or certificate of class 10
  • Mark sheet or certificate of class 12
  • A valid ID proof issued by the Government
  • 7 to 8 passport size photograph
  • If required disability certificate 
  • Allotment letter

Aspirants must have to carry both original & Xerox copy of the documents that are required in the upper list.

NEET 2023 Seat Allotment Process

  • Seat Allocation list will prepare on the basis of your AIR got in the NEET exam 2023 & choices filled in the registration form.
  • You can check the seat allocation list on the official web page of MCC. 
  • If he/she accepted the allotted seat then they’ve to download the NEET allotment letter from the web page by filling roll number, DOB & security pin. 
  • A student who has allotted for counselling has to report to the allotted institute for seat confirmation and document verification.
  • After that aspirants have to undergo a medical check-up to make sure that they particular candidate is medically fit or not. 
  • If that aspirants doesn’t appear in the institute till the last date for the process, their seat will cancel.
